Customized Plyometric Programs for Different Fitness Levels

Plyometric training has become increasingly popular among individuals looking to enhance their athletic performance and overall fitness. By focusing on explosive movements, plyometrics improves power, speed, and agility. When developing a customized plyometric program, it is crucial to consider individual fitness levels, goals, and other health factors. Beginners may require a more foundational approach, while advanced athletes can engage in more complex exercises. Having a structured program allows for appropriate progressions that prevent injuries and promote effectiveness. Plyometrics engages both muscular strength and cardiovascular endurance, making it an excellent addition to training regimens. This type of training also aids in improving coordination, balance, and flexibility. It is essential to include exercises that suit one’s current abilities and to continually challenge the body as it adapts. To ensure optimal results, incorporating rest days for recovery and muscle repair is vital. Listening to one’s body during workouts is key to implementing modifications as needed. Therefore, individuals must understand their capacities and consult with professionals to design tailored plyometric routines.

When considering customization, beginners should focus on mastering fundamental bodyweight exercises before progressing to more advanced drills. Starter exercises include jump squats and box jumps, which help build strength and explosiveness. Gradually increasing the intensity and volume of workouts can promote adaptation without overwhelming the body. As fitness levels improve, individuals can incorporate variations such as single-leg hops and lateral jumps to challenge themselves further. These exercises engage different muscle groups while maintaining safety. Strengthening the core is also essential when performing plyometric movements, as it stabilizes the body during explosive actions. Additionally, encouraging proper technique ensures that energy is efficiently transferred throughout the body, reducing injury risk. Maintaining a balanced approach between endurance training and plyometric sessions is vital for optimal performance outcomes. Advanced athletes can shift towards more sport-specific plyometric exercises that mimic the demands of their specific activities. This may involve higher intensity movements and decreased rest periods to enhance the body’s ability to recover and perform under stress. Ultimately, understanding individual fitness levels in conjunction with desired outcomes allows for more effective training and progress.

Plyometric Exercises for Intermediate Levels

Intermediate exercisers possess a higher fitness level and can engage in more dynamic plyometric workouts. At this stage, it is essential to focus on increasing intensity through added complexity in techniques. Exercises like depth jumps and plyometric push-ups elevate the challenge level, stimulating further muscle growth and strengthening. Continuous monitoring of form and control during exercises ensures that the participant remains safe and minimizes injury risks. Utilizing tools such as resistance bands, cones, or hurdles can create varied resistance and height challenges. These variations not only keep workouts engaging but also optimize functional training for several physical athletic endeavors. Additionally, incorporating duration-based workouts can enhance cardiovascular fitness alongside plyometric benefits. Combining strength training and plyometrics produces superior results, as enhanced muscular endurance supports explosive movements. Rest is equally paramount; ensuring adequate recovery between sessions allows muscles to heal and grow stronger. Developing a well-rounded routine means layering the plyometric work with other training elements, ensuring muscle balance while maximizing performance. Ultimately, increasing proficiency in plyometrics at an intermediate level opens doors to advanced training methodologies.

When transitioning to advanced plyometric programs, athletes often explore varied and technical exercises for explosive strength. Movements like triple hops, bounding drills, and depth landings enhance neuromuscular efficiency. This segment of training focuses on optimizing speed and reaction time critical to many sports. Athletes are encouraged to execute exercises with precision, which maximizes energy transfer and effectiveness. Furthermore, the integration of functional movements that prepare the body for sport-specific scenarios is vital. Advanced plyometric routines should challenge both unilateral and bilateral movement patterns. For example, emphasizing single-leg bounding can elevate strength and muscular coordination. Athletes must also consider periodization principles, balancing high-intensity plyometrics with lower intensity recovery sessions. This systematic approach minimizes injuries while promoting continuous adaptations. Monitoring progress through well-defined performance metrics helps in altering routines efficiently. Always prioritize a solid warm-up to improve muscle elasticity and readiness for explosive movements. Finally, including a cooldown phase post-workout encourages proper recovery and muscle relaxation. Advanced training must integrate scientific principles for peak physical performance while remaining mindful of training loads and recovery demands.

Benefits of Plyometric Training

The advantages of plyometric training are abundant, ranging from increased power output to improved athletic performance. Engaging in these high-intensity workouts promotes faster muscle fiber recruitment, which is essential for explosive movements. Consequently, athletes notice significant improvements in sprinting speed, vertical leap, and overall agility. Another benefit involves enhanced cardiovascular conditioning, as plyometric drills often incorporate repetitive dynamic movements leading to increased heart rates. This form of training also aids in burning calories effectively, making it a valuable asset to fat loss programs. Enhanced joint stability from plyometric exercises results in better overall functional fitness and reduces the risk of injuries. Players of various sports, including basketball and soccer, experience enhanced performance due to the reactive strength gained through plyometrics. By incorporating this type of training, individuals not only develop faster muscles but also sharpen their mental preparation for competitive scenarios. Performing explosive drills cultivates mental resilience and readiness. Creating a specialized approach allows individuals to assess benefits personalized to their unique goals. Therefore, a commitment to a consistent plyometric program yields substantial long-term fitness results.

To maximize the outcomes of a plyometric training program, proper technique is paramount. Each exercise requires the correct form to ensure safety and efficiency. Beginners should prioritize learning basic movements under professional guidance before increasing intensity or complexity. Training in a controlled environment with supervision allows immediate feedback for any potential physical complications. As competence improves, individuals can gradually modify their workout regimens, introducing more advanced drills to engage muscle groups fully. Nutrition plays a vital role in plyometric training, as adequate fuel enables peak performance. Individuals should consume a balanced diet rich in protein to facilitate muscle repair and growth, alongside complex carbohydrates for energy. Staying hydrated is equally important; dehydration can impair physical performance and recovery, counteracting the benefits of intense workouts. Visits to health professionals, such as nutritionists, can assist in optimizing dietary habits for training. Furthermore, regular reassessments of one’s program allow adjustments according to evolving fitness levels and personal goals. Thus, incorporating nutrition, technique, and feedback effectively enhances the impacts of any plyometric training regimen.
